Hey — handing over the snapshot testing setup for the Bramblewick component library. Snapshots live next to each component and regenerate via the usual test runner flag. Main gotcha: date pickers need the frozen-clock helper or you'll get flaky diffs every midnight. Review snapshot diffs carefully before approving; huge diffs usually mean a theme token changed upstream. I've written up the quirks and the approval workflow on the internal page below.

operations page: https://jira.qorvelsys.internal/browse/pages/browse/pages

Welcome aboard! Here at Glimmerbyte we snapshot-test every UI component in the Pennywhistle design system. The idea is simple: render the component, capture its output, and compare it against a stored baseline. If your change alters the snapshot, the test fails until you review and approve the diff. Don't just blindly update snapshots — eyeball each one, since subtle regressions love to hide there. Run the suite locally before pushing. The full workflow, including approval commands and CI quirks, is documented here:

dashboard of bawif-bagug = https://jira.lumicsys.internal/display/browse/display/6135ac61

Subject: Bike cage and parking gates — updated access

Hi all,

From Monday, the bike cage behind Arden House and both parking gates at the Torwell site switch to the new reader system. Old fobs stop working Friday evening. Please remind your teams to collect updated passes from the front desk before then. Until everyone has a new pass, the gates will accept the temporary staff code below.

turnstile pass: bdg-PD-2